Don't Hand It Down came from one simple thought: what if we kept everything beautiful about where we come from, without passing the hatred on with it?

Belfast is a city that knows what it means to inherit history. Names, streets, colours, traditions and stories can carry meaning long before we're born. This song isn't asking anyone to forget where they come from. It's asking what we choose to carry forward.
